AFTER-SCHOOL TUTORING & MENTORING

OGB’s signature program is its After-School Tutoring and Mentoring Program. We work closely with the Sycamore Community Schools to identify students in 1st – 8th grades who would benefit from academic support or assistance with other skills. We enroll approximately 45 students per year, each of whom are transported by Sycamore District Buses for 2½ hours of after-school tutoring, three days per week. We have a cheerful 6,000 sq. ft. “home”, which offers plenty of space for our volunteer tutors to engage with our OGB students, offering them the support needed to reach academic success. The progress of our students can be seen in improved grades, enhanced self-confidence, and the demonstration of life skills that they can take onto higher education and into the working world.

MORE ABOUT OUR TUTORING PROGRAM

  • Students and their families commit to program requirements, including attendance, goal-setting & monitoring, and parental involvement. 

  • The after-school tutoring program runs September to May.

  • Healthy snacks are offered each afternoon.

  • Students work individually or in small groups with trained, dedicated adult and senior-high tutors.

  • Students receive verbal recognition and encouragement for improvements in their grades, test scores, performance, and overall commitment to their growth.

  • Our facility houses a library of over 3,000 books and novels, as well as fifteen computer terminals. OGB provides critical access to computers since many of these students do not have connectivity at home to complete required online activities. 

  • If necessary, transportation home is provided in OGB’s van.

  • On Thursdays, Whiz Kids extends the program one hour with a focus on increasing reading literacy.

  • Summer tutoring is also provided at the OGB Center to avoid the learning losses that can occur when students are not participating in educational activities.
